When you are running late or have a long stretch of highway ahead, driving a little faster might seem like an easy way to save time. But there is another factor to consider: fuel consumption. Your speed can have a noticeable effect on how efficiently your vehicle uses gas.

So, does driving faster use more gas? In most cases, yes. As your speed increases, your vehicle has to work harder to overcome aerodynamic drag and other forces. This can cause fuel economy to decline, particularly at higher highway speeds.

Speed is not the only factor that determines how much fuel your car uses. Vehicle design, engine size, weather, traffic, tire pressure, and driving habits all play a role. Understanding the relationship between speed and fuel economy can help you make more efficient choices behind the wheel.

Why Does Driving Faster Use More Fuel?

Your engine needs energy to move your vehicle forward. As you accelerate, the engine burns fuel to generate that energy.

Once you reach highway speeds, aerodynamic drag becomes increasingly important. Air pushes against the front and other surfaces of the vehicle as it moves. The faster you travel, the greater this resistance becomes.

Your engine has to produce additional power to maintain higher speeds against that resistance. Producing more power generally requires more fuel.

This is why increasing your highway speed can reduce your MPG even though you are covering more miles in less time.

What Is the Most Fuel-Efficient Driving Speed?

There is no single speed that delivers the best fuel economy for every vehicle.

Engine design, transmission gearing, aerodynamics, vehicle weight, tire type, and other factors determine where a particular car operates most efficiently.

According to the U.S. Department of Energy, fuel economy generally decreases rapidly at speeds above 50 mph. The exact impact varies by vehicle, but higher speeds typically mean increased fuel consumption.

That does not mean you should drive unusually slowly to save gas. Driving significantly below surrounding traffic can create safety concerns.

Always follow posted speed limits and adjust your speed based on traffic, road, and weather conditions.

Is Highway Driving More Fuel-Efficient?

Many gasoline-powered vehicles receive higher EPA highway fuel economy ratings than city ratings, even though highway driving usually involves higher speeds.

The reason is that city driving involves frequent stopping and starting.

Every time you accelerate from a stop, your engine must use energy to bring the vehicle back up to speed. Stoplights, traffic congestion, intersections, and repeated braking can increase fuel consumption.

On the highway, a vehicle may maintain a relatively steady speed for long periods. That can be more efficient than constantly accelerating and braking.

However, there is a point where additional speed begins working against that advantage. Driving substantially faster increases aerodynamic resistance and can reduce highway fuel economy.

Rapid Acceleration Can Hurt Gas Mileage

Speed itself is only part of the equation. How you reach that speed also matters.

Pressing aggressively on the accelerator asks the engine to deliver more power quickly, which can increase fuel consumption. Repeated hard acceleration followed by heavy braking wastes energy that could have been conserved with smoother driving.

When traffic conditions allow, accelerate gradually and maintain a consistent speed.

Looking farther ahead can also help. If you see traffic slowing or a red light ahead, easing off the accelerator earlier may reduce the need for hard braking.

Small changes in driving style can add up, particularly if you spend a lot of time commuting.

Does Cruise Control Save Gas?

Cruise control can sometimes help improve fuel efficiency by maintaining a consistent speed, particularly on relatively flat highways.

Without cruise control, drivers may unintentionally speed up and slow down repeatedly. These fluctuations can require additional acceleration and fuel.

However, cruise control is not always the most efficient choice.

On steep or rolling terrain, the system may accelerate aggressively to maintain the selected speed while climbing hills. Depending on the vehicle and road, controlling your speed manually may sometimes be more efficient.

More importantly, only use cruise control when road and weather conditions make it safe to do so.

Does Vehicle Type Make a Difference?

Yes. The effect of higher speeds can vary depending on what you drive.

Aerodynamics play a major role in highway efficiency. A low, streamlined car generally moves through the air differently than a tall, box-shaped vehicle.

Large trucks and SUVs may experience more aerodynamic drag because of their size and shape. Vehicle weight, tires, drivetrain, engine, and transmission also influence fuel consumption.

Hybrids can behave differently as well. Many hybrids achieve particularly strong fuel economy in city conditions because regenerative braking can recover some energy during deceleration and their electric motors can assist during lower-speed driving.

This is why you should compare fuel economy based on your specific vehicle rather than assuming every car will respond to driving conditions in the same way.

Other Driving Habits That Can Increase Fuel Consumption

Driving too fast is not the only habit that can send you to the gas station more often.

Excessive idling burns fuel without moving the vehicle. Carrying unnecessary heavy items can also increase the amount of energy required to accelerate.

Roof-mounted cargo boxes and racks can increase aerodynamic drag, particularly at highway speeds.

Even vehicle maintenance matters. Underinflated tires can increase rolling resistance, while certain mechanical problems can cause the engine to operate less efficiently.

If your MPG has suddenly dropped without a significant change in your driving habits, it may be worth checking your tire pressure and considering whether your vehicle needs an inspection.

How Can You Get Better Gas Mileage?

Improving fuel economy does not require driving as slowly as possible.

Instead, focus on smooth and consistent driving. Avoid unnecessary rapid acceleration, anticipate traffic changes, and follow posted speed limits. Keeping your tires properly inflated and staying current with recommended maintenance can also support efficient vehicle operation.

If you track your MPG regularly, you may begin to notice which driving habits and routes produce the best results.

Keep in mind that weather, traffic, fuel formulation, road conditions, and even how much cargo you are carrying can cause fuel economy to change from one trip to another.
